Di era teknologi yang semakin berkembang pesat, keberadaan website responsif menjadi hal yang sangat penting dan tak terelakkan. Sebuah website responsif memastikan bahwa tampilan dan fungsionalitas website tetap optimal pada berbagai ukuran layar dan perangkat, mulai dari smartphone, tablet, hingga komputer desktop. Kualitas dan kemudahan pengalaman pengguna (user experience) menjadi faktor utama dalam menarik dan mempertahankan pengunjung website.
Dalam konteks ini, framework CSS memainkan peran penting dalam membantu pengembang menciptakan website yang responsif dan efisien. Framework CSS adalah kumpulan kode CSS yang telah dirancang sebelumnya, yang memungkinkan pengembang untuk mengurangi waktu dan upaya dalam pengembangan website. Dengan menggunakan framework CSS, pengembang dapat fokus pada konten dan fungsionalitas website, daripada menghabiskan waktu untuk mengatur tampilan pada berbagai ukuran layar.
Berbagai framework CSS hadir dengan kelebihan dan kekurangan masing-masing, serta fokus pada aspek-aspek tertentu dalam pembuatan website responsif. Oleh karena itu, memilih framework CSS yang tepat menjadi langkah awal yang penting dalam memastikan kesuksesan proyek pengembangan web Anda. Artikel ini akan membahas 10 framework CSS terbaik yang dapat Anda gunakan untuk menciptakan website responsif yang optimal, menarik, dan mudah digunakan.
Berikut ini adalah 10 framework CSS terbaik yang bisa Anda gunakan untuk membangun website responsif.
1. Bootstrap
Mengapa Bootstrap begitu populer?
Bootstrap merupakan framework CSS yang paling populer dan sering digunakan oleh para developer web. Dibuat oleh Twitter, Bootstrap menyediakan berbagai komponen yang mudah digunakan untuk membuat website responsif. Kelebihan dari Bootstrap antara lain:
- Kompatibel dengan berbagai browser modern
- Mudah diintegrasikan dengan library JavaScript
- Banyak tema yang tersedia
2. Foundation
Keunggulan Foundation dalam pengembangan website responsif
Foundation adalah framework CSS yang dikembangkan oleh ZURB, sebuah perusahaan desain dan pengembangan web. Foundation menawarkan fitur yang lebih fleksibel dibandingkan Bootstrap, seperti:
- Grid responsif yang fleksibel
- Berbagai komponen UI yang mudah digunakan
- Dukungan untuk pengembangan aplikasi mobile
3. Bulma
Bulma, framework CSS modern dan ringan
Bulma adalah framework CSS yang relatif baru dan ringan. Dibangun dengan Flexbox, Bulma menawarkan kemudahan dalam pembuatan layout responsif dengan kode yang lebih sederhana. Kelebihan Bulma antara lain:
- Dibangun dengan Flexbox
- Desain minimalis dan modern
- Tidak memerlukan JavaScript
4. Semantic UI
Semantic UI, pendekatan berbasis makna dalam pembuatan website
Semantic UI adalah framework CSS yang menawarkan pendekatan berbasis makna dalam pembuatan website. Dengan menggunakan kelas yang mudah dipahami, Semantic UI memudahkan developer dalam memahami struktur kode. Keunggulan Semantic UI meliputi:
- Kelas yang mudah dipahami
- Berbagai komponen UI yang kaya
- Integrasi dengan berbagai library JavaScript
5. Tailwind CSS
Tailwind CSS, fleksibilitas dalam mendesain website responsif
Tailwind CSS merupakan framework CSS yang memberikan fleksibilitas dalam mendesain website responsif. Dengan menggunakan sistem utilitas, Tailwind CSS memungkinkan developer untuk menciptakan desain yang unik dan responsif dengan mudah. Kelebihan Tailwind CSS antara lain:
- Sistem utilitas yang fleksibel
- Mudah dikustomisasi
- Tidak memerlukan komponen UI yang pre-built
6. Materialize
Materialize, aplikasi desain material dalam pengembangan website
Materialize adalah framework CSS yang mengimplementasikan konsep Material Design dari Google. Dengan tampilan yang modern dan elegan, Materialize memudahkan pengembang untuk menciptakan website yang menarik. Keunggulan Materialize meliputi:
- Desain modern berdasarkan Material Design
- Beragam komponen UI yang mudah digunakan
- Dukungan untuk animasi dan efek transisi
7. UIKit
UIKit, kerangka kerja ringan untuk pengembangan website responsif
UIKit adalah framework CSS yang ringan dan modular. Cocok untuk pengembang yang menginginkan kontrol lebih dalam pengembangan website responsif. Kelebihan UIKit antara lain:
- Modular dan ringan
- Komponen UI yang mudah dikustomisasi
- Dukungan animasi dan efek transisi
8. Tachyons
Tachyons, kecepatan dan efisiensi dalam pembuatan website
Tachyons adalah framework CSS yang menawarkan kecepatan dan efisiensi dalam pembuatan website responsif. Dengan pendekatan berbasis utilitas, Tachyons memungkinkan developer untuk menulis kode CSS yang lebih ringkas. Keunggulan Tachyons meliputi:
- Kode CSS ringkas
- Efisiensi dalam pembuatan website
- Mudah dikustomisasi
9. Spectre.css
Spectre.css, desain modern dengan ukuran ringan
Spectre.css adalah framework CSS yang ringan dengan desain modern. Cocok untuk developer yang menginginkan tampilan elegan tanpa menambah beban berat pada website. Kelebihan Spectre.css antara lain:
- Desain modern dan elegan
- Ukuran ringan
- Mudah dikustomisasi
10. Primer
Primer, framework CSS dari GitHub untuk pengembangan website
Primer merupakan framework CSS yang dikembangkan oleh GitHub. Dengan fokus pada desain sistem dan aksesibilitas, Primer cocok untuk developer yang mengutamakan konsistensi dan kegunaan. Kelebihan Primer meliputi:
- Desain sistem yang konsisten
- Fokus pada aksesibilitas
- Mudah digunakan dan dikustomisasi
Kesimpulan
Framework CSS telah membantu pengembang web dalam menciptakan website responsif yang mudah diakses di berbagai perangkat. Dalam artikel ini, kita telah membahas 10 framework CSS terbaik yang bisa Anda gunakan untuk membangun website responsif. Pilihlah framework yang paling sesuai dengan kebutuhan Anda dan mulailah menciptakan website yang menarik dan responsif!
sebelum memulai belajar framework CSS, tentus saja kita harus mengerti dulu bahasa CSS sebelum memulai menggunakan framework nya. Jika anda belum paham atau mengerti menggunakan CSS, anda bisa lihat tutorial CSS dengan seri lengkap melalui link berikut ini https://www.iltekkomputer.com/belajar/css/.
FAQ
- Apa itu framework CSS?
Framework CSS adalah kumpulan kode CSS yang telah dirancang sebelumnya untuk membantu developer dalam pembuatan website responsif. - Mengapa menggunakan framework CSS?
Menggunakan framework CSS memudahkan developer dalam menciptakan website yang responsif dan efisien, serta mengurangi waktu pengembangan. - Apakah saya perlu menguasai semua framework CSS?
Tidak perlu, pilih satu atau beberapa framework yang paling sesuai dengan kebutuhan Anda dan fokus untuk menguasai mereka. - Bagaimana cara memilih framework CSS yang tepat?
Untuk memilih framework CSS yang tepat, pertimbangkan faktor-faktor seperti kebutuhan proyek Anda, kemudahan penggunaan, dukungan komunitas, dan fleksibilitas dalam kustomisasi. Anda juga dapat mencoba beberapa framework yang berbeda untuk menemukan mana yang paling cocok dengan gaya kerja dan preferensi Anda.